Your Aastra 6731i phone that works with AT&T Voice DNA has a standard phone keypad and a few additional
buttons (for example, a Hold button). It also has two hard line keys with lights that show which ones are
active.
The phone also has options and features that appear in the display window. To select a function, use the
navigation keys (above the keypad), and then follow the directions in the display window. In this guide, we
refer to soft keys by the label that appears in the display window describing the function at a particular time.
